About the role
We’re looking for a motivated Technologist to join our dedicated team at our Narellan Field Service Centre. You’ll play a key role in constructing HV Switchyards, installing and wiring Protection and Control Panels, and maintaining associated equipment of Zone and Transmission Substations across Transmission South.
You’ll also have the opportunity to contribute to external projects with our partners or in other regions, depending on operational needs.
Essential requirements
- Certificate III in Electrotechnology Electrician
- Proven strong safety awareness and commitment
- Proven ability to work effectively in small teams
- Self‑motivated and open to ongoing training
Desirable
- Wiring Large Control Panels
- Understanding Schematical and Mechanical Drawings
- Experience in a high‑voltage (HV) industry
- Experience maintaining HV circuit breakers and transformers
- Familiarity with the construction and maintenance of Zone and Transmission Substations
- Previous work in HV environments
- Class C or MR driver’s licence
- Fibre Optics Splicing Trained
